Job Description:
We are developing autonomous mobility solutions that require high fleet availability to support testing, mapping, and operational readiness. The Level 3 Toyota Highlander fleet plays a critical role in these efforts, and the Sustaining Engineering team owns the reliability and availability of these vehicles in operation. As a Sustaining Engineer, you will support the L3 test fleet by resolving issues across both OEM vehicle systems and integrated AV hardware.

This role requires broad ownership across electrical and mechanical systems, with a strong focus on execution and fleet impact.

You will drive end-to-end resolution of field and manufacturing issues, from root cause through solution development, validation, release, and implementation into the manufacturing line and service fleet. You will work closely with Serviceability & Manufacturing Engineering and cross-functional partners to ensure solutions are robust, scalable, and aligned with Design for Service (Client) and Design for Manufacturing (DFM) requirements. Your work will directly improve fleet uptime, reduce downtime drivers, and improve reliability metrics such as MTBF.

Responsibilities:
  • Own sustaining engineering support and corrective action development for the Level 3 Toyota Highlander test and mapping fleet across OEM vehicle systems and integrated AV hardware, from root cause confirmation through fleet-wide implementation
  • Drive end-to-end resolution of vehicle and AV system issues, including diagnosis, troubleshooting, root cause analysis, solution development, validation, release, and implementation into the service fleet
  • Lead design updates and improvements for our client and Toyota components and subsystems to improve reliability, durability, fleet availability, and serviceability across electrical and mechanical systems
  • Author and manage Engineering Change Requests and Change Actions, develop and execute validation and test plans, and lead fleet trials to verify long term effectiveness of implemented changes
  • Support retrofit campaigns, rework activities, installation trials, and field failure triage, partnering with service, test, and operations teams to restore vehicles to service quickly and effectively
  • Partner with suppliers, Manufacturing, and Serviceability Engineering to deliver durable, manufacturable, and serviceable solutions that meet Design for Service and Design for Manufacturing requirements
  • Apply fleet data, technician feedback, and reliability metrics such as MTBF and repeat failure trends to prioritize work, validate corrective actions, and prevent recurrence
